* Update USE_GITHUB so it does not require GH_COMMIT.Bryan Drewery2015-03-191-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Using this new scheme allows only setting the _tag_ or _commit hash_ in GH_TAGNAME and not having to know the hash for a tag. This scheme will download a tarball that has a different checksum than before due to a changed directory name for extraction. The following MASTER_SITES are provided to retain the old checksum and directory structure (that require GH_COMMIT): GH -> GHL GITHUB -> GITHUB_LEGACY Differential Revision: https://reviews.freebsd.org/D748 Submitted by: amdmi3 Reviewed by: mat, swills, antoine, bdrewery With hat: portmgr Notes: svn path=/head/; revision=381618

* ua is a simple command-line tool that finds sets of identical files.Dirk Meyer2009-01-133-0/+40
The name ua is derived from the Hungarian word ugyanaz meaning the same. The development of ua was motivated by the disturbingly often recurring event of waiting too long for a shell script using sorts, md5sums, diffs and the like to finish finding identical files. While there are many tools out there, we needed a tool that can ignore white spaces and runs quite fast. WWW: http://oss.euedge.com/wiki/UaMainPage Notes: svn path=/head/; revision=225974
